Commit graph

6 commits

Author SHA1 Message Date
Vincent Ambo
0bc619e1d0 chore(fun/tvl): Add more missing persons 2020-04-21 02:37:27 +01:00
Vincent Ambo
fd13489cc9 style(fun/tvl): Use a different font for the TVL graph
... plus some other minor changes
2020-04-21 00:28:22 +01:00
Vincent Ambo
9ff5d46034 feat(fun/tvl): Add graph for how loungers know each other
Rendered version at https://tazj.in/blobs/tvl.png

Rendered using `neato`.
2020-04-20 23:55:45 +01:00
Vincent Ambo
24151f06dd chore(fun/tvl): Increase framerate to 60fps & limit queue size
The queue size setting will drop frames if the encoding starts to lag
behind, which should prevent delay from being introduced on the
serving side.

Maybe.
2020-04-04 02:54:49 +01:00
Vincent Ambo
bcfa11599d feat(fun/tvl): Implement hardware-accelerated stream rescaling
By randomly copy & pasting options that are impenetrable to mere
mortals from NVIDIA's developer blog and a bunch of gists scattered
throughout the internet, Andi and I managed to "get this to work".

The idea is that the x11grab stream should be resized into 720p (which
is the maximum supported by Google Meet), but with hardware
acceleration.
2020-04-04 02:36:20 +01:00
Vincent Ambo
f8703d12da feat(fun/tvl): Initial working ffmpeg -> nginx stream command 2020-04-04 02:36:20 +01:00